Scouting America charters first girls’ troop in BullochWorking in partnership with Scouting America, American Legion Dexter Allen Post 90 made a little history last week: The post played host to a signing event that chartered the first-ever all girls’ troop in Bulloch County. Following the changing of the Boy Scouts of America name to Scouts BSA in 2019, the group officially became Scouting America in February. It currently has approximately 1 million members across the nation, including 176,000 girls.March 12, 2025

'Blessing of the Crops'On a cool, clear Tuesday morning, about 200 people gathered for Bulloch County's annual Blessing of the Crops at the Hunter Cattle Company farm in Stilson. Sponsored by the Statesboro-Bulloch Chamber of Commerce, Morris Bank Market President John Roach welcomed the group. "As we gather for the Blessing of the Crops, we recognize the tireless efforts of our agricultural community — the backbone of our region's prosperity," Roach said. "In partnerships like this, we reaffirm our commitment to supporting sustainable farming practices and ensuring a vibrant future for Bulloch County's agricultural heritage."March 5, 2025

Leefield-area house fire displaces familyA southeast Bulloch County family is receiving comfort and aid today after a fire raged through the attic of their home early Sunday morning, leaving the residence unlivable. Fire Prevention Chief Joe Carter with the Bulloch County Fire Department said Engine 7 from the Brooklet Fire Station arrived on the scene of the home on Bennett Grooms Road at 1:06 a.m., 11 minutes after a 911 call was received about a fire inside the home.January 14, 2025

After nine years, Boro genealogy librarian heading homeA self-described genealogy “nerd,” Lillian Wingate became the Statesboro-Bulloch County Library’s genealogy librarian in 2015 and has helped hundreds of area residents trace family histories and gain an appreciation of their past. But, after nine years, Wingate is moving closer to her own family’s home in south Georgia to become the executive director of the Genealogy Library at Thomas University in Thomasville.January 7, 2025
